4. CONCRETE SLAB

Concrete Slab: It is recommended that your new shed is secured to a concrete slab as shown below.
Please ensure that your site is level. It is recommended that your slab is 100mm thick and you use a plastic
membrane and a suitable reinforcing mesh. We recommend that you make your slab 100mm bigger than the
base dimensions of your shed. This will allow for a 50mm edge around your shed. We recommend that you
slope the 50mm edges downward by 10mm so that rain water will drain away from your shed.

CONTENTS
Check contents: Lay out all components with the part numbers facing upwards and check off against the
parts lists on the next four pages. In the unlikely event of a missing component please contact your local
Sealey dealer.
